I’m totally with Okrand on {‘aS} being preferable to {‘oS} to transliterate “Oz”, in terms of vowel sound, but I wonder about transliteration of the English “Z” into Klingon. 

Logically, we can deduce that {S} is the closest sound in Klingon to the English “Z", but I wonder if the vocalization of the “Z” would bother them enough that they’d simulate it with some vocalized sound next to it, like {‘aghSe’}.

That actually sounds closer to “Oz” to my ear than {‘aS}.
